Simple Gravy

  1. Remove the roast meat from the roasting pan and keep warm. Place the pan (ensure that it is flame-proof) on top of the stove, over a medium heat. Bring the pan drippings to a boil then reduce the heat and simmer until all juices in the pan have evaporated and only the fat remains. Pour off the excess fat from the pan leaving approximately 6 tbsp of fat.
  2. Leave the the roasting pan on a medium heat and add the flour, then stir until combined with the fat.
  3. Reduce the heat to low and continue stirring until the flour is of a good brown consistency. Do not allow to burn.
  4. Remove the roasting pan from the heat and add the stock all at once, stirring constantly. Continue stirring until the flour and stock have combined.
  5. Return the roasting pan to a medium heat and stir until the sauce boils and thickens. Season, then simmer the gravy, uncovered,for 3 mins, stirring occasionally.
